NBA veteran, Austin Rivers, is joined by one of his oldest friends, Pausha Haghighi, to give you that true insider’s perspective from someone who’s actively playing in the league on anything and everything happening inside the NBA. They hit on the biggest headlines and stories and of course sprinkle in some of the best stories and memories from Austin’s extensive career.
